WebJan 12, 2024 · The total cost of ownership (TCO) refers to how much it costs to purchase, own and operate an asset. Finance experts in a wide variety of industries calculate the total cost of ownership of assets to learn about their value compared to the expense of purchasing, using and maintaining them. Purchase price + implementation costs + operating costs (for the next 5 to 10 years that the new system will be in use). The first two parts of the formula, purchase price and implementation costs are fairly easy to define.
